MEMO — Marketing Budget Reduction

To: Finance Team

Effective next quarter, the marketing budget for the Lorvane product group is reduced by 18%. Paid campaigns in the Ashfield and Tarnow regions are suspended; event sponsorships continue. Savings are redirected pending executive allocation. Update forecasts accordingly by month-end. The confidential reasoning behind this shift follows below.

confidential, kagup-bafog: Fraaxax Group is in early talks to buy Soroxox Group for about $343.8 million. The Olidor launch date is June 14, and nothing goes to the press before then. Legal wants the Aldmirek Logistics term sheet signed before July 23.

CI note for weekly sync: the Thornbury greenhouse controller tests started failing Tuesday due to simulated humidity-sensor drift exceeding the calibration window. Root cause was a stale fixture seed, not firmware. Fixture regenerated; drift bounds now asserted per-sensor. Two flaky temperature cases remain quarantined pending the Oakhaven rig repair. The passing build's trace token is recorded below.

pipeline stamp: htk31_f769b577b3028a4e9958e5bb8d1259a

Break-glass access — i18n extraction. The extract-strings script for Project Tansy runs nightly; if it wedges, the on-call may trigger it manually via the locked runner. Discuss misuse at the weekly eng sync. Manual runs require unlocking the runner's sealed credentials, so enter the recovery passphrase given on the line below.

unlock words, hahip-yagef: zorok-novmir-zorix-silax

## Step 2: Wire up Deploybeak

Before Deploybeak can post deploy status to the team channel, it needs a scoped service account — please sanity-check that the scopes below are read-only, since the bot should never be able to trigger a deploy itself. It only listens to the Fernwheel pipeline events and replies in-channel. Its runtime reads these configuration values on startup.

config for tajof-yaguf:
[istox]
team = aldius
access_code = ac_29be1b
owner = holok.praix
host = istox.zarqelsoft.test
port = 11211
peer = novath.olvarqio.example
salt = 983a9dc6
pin = 4652